In order to get or explore Math possibilities in Moodle, some additional software on server must be installed.
CentOS example:
As root user:
yum install tetex tetex-fonts tetex-dvips tetex-latex ghostscript
As MoodleMaster/Admin Level user in Moodle
Site Administration -> Modules -> Filters -> Manage Filters
Un-hide Algebra Notation and TeX Notation
Settings for TeX Notation:
IF the install above went ok, there should be nothing to change.
Look for the check marks and Save Changes.
Path of latex binaryfilter_tex_pathlatex (check mark) Default: /usr/bin/latex
Path of dvips binaryfilter_tex_pathdvips (check mark) Default: /usr/bin/dvips
Path of convert binaryfilter_tex_pathconvert (check mark) Default: /usr/bin/convert
Create a web page resource (this taken from the famous "Moodle Features Demo" course) with the following:
Name: Mathematics notation
Summary: Moodle is a unique system in providing easy ways to produce good looking mathematics.
Web Page content:-- begin copy below this line --
TeX Filter
This filter allows you to type in any standard Tex within dollars signs, anywhere in Moodle (including forums etc) like this:
$$$ \Bigsum_{i=\1}^{n-\1}\frac1{\Del~x}\Bigint_{x_i}^{x_{i+\1}}\{\frac1{\Del~x}\big[(x_{i+1}-x)y_i^{5$\star}\big]-f(x)\}^\2dx$$$
and it will be displayed efficiently like this:
$$ \Bigsum_{i=\1}^{n-\1}\frac1{\Del~x}\Bigint_{x_i}^{x_{i+\1}}\{\frac1{\Del~x}\big[(x_{i+1}-x)y_i^{5$\star}\big]-f(x)\}^\2dx$$
Algebra Filter
The algebra filter is similar but allows a more informal calculator-like notation within @@@ characters:
@@@cosh(x,2)-sinh(x,2)=1@@@
@@cosh(x,2)-sinh(x,2)=1@@
